He's still a bit of distance behind the top three or four, but - as I will eternally say - picking the person who dances best week one isn't necessarily picking the winner in December. You want someone who doesn't take the audience's money every week, as they'll have none left by the final Smiley

It's a very open competition. Hollyoaks man is definitely better right now, but he has a few issues and he might not improve a lot. Ben I suspect is more likely to progress. But we are speculating, as fun as that is. Patrick also has a fair bit of promise. His weakness is his popularity: Ben has huge appeal and so does Kristina; plenty of people still don't know Anya's surname.


47/1 to win? I don't think I'd even back that now, but the top two are women, arguably three, and there's three abs no hopers in the fellas, 4 of the top 5 in the betting are women, but I don't think the top man, hollyoaks guy, is partic good.

Fwiw I think Nat is head n shoulders looking like the best dancer, tho they don't always win, they generally do. Sophie pretty good but is closer to gawky than graceful, Abbey just a bit behind those two with the newsreader milf and hollyoaks guy with big Ben improving to get into that group

Darren Gough won in a final with Colin Jackson and Zoë Ball, both of whom were better dancers throughout the comp.

Ali Bastian and Ricky Whittle were both better dancers than Chris Hollins, but it was the BBC presenter who won.

Against that, Mark Ramprakash and Alesha Dixon led from start to finish. They were head and shoulders above their fields, though, where Gumede is the best of a group of three or four.

« Reply #57387 on: October 20, 2013, 08:22:58 PM »

I remember a few weeks ago Tighty came up with an interesting angle regarding a ref in the NFL.  Who was it and which games does he have this week?

I posted about 20 pages ago on Thursday, but didn't recieve a response

Carl Cheffers

He has Denver at Indy

Indy+7 is the first home underdog he has had since I did the original piece

I particularly liked it because the public money is all for Manning and we might see +7.5 near kick off

Cheffers is currently 33 of 37 home winners, outright, over six years
